Here at ValueWalk, we often cover research reports from Fundstrat Global Advisors, a relatively new research outfit, which has quickly made a name for itself. Fundstrat was founded in 2014 by Tom Lee, formerly the chief US equity strategist for JP Morgan, with the goal of providing client-focused research…
